One of the most renowned of the European court jesters was Nasir Ed Din (https://all0ccperf0rm.mystrikingly.com/). One day the king glimpsed himself and a mirror, and saddened at exactly how old he looked, started weeping.




When the king quit sobbing, every person else quit sobbing also, other than Nasir Ed Hubbub. When the king asked Nasir why he was still weeping, he responded, "Sire, you considered yourself in the mirror however for a minute and you sobbed. I need to consider you constantly." It consisted of lots of comic characters split right into masters and slaves. There were 3 sorts of comic slaves: the First Zany, the Second Zany, and the Fantesca. The First Zany was a male servant that was a brilliant rogue usually plotting against the masters. The Second Zany was a stupid male slave that was caught up in the First Zany's plans and often the sufferer of his tricks.

Philip Astley created what is taken into consideration the initial circus in England in 1768. He additionally developed the initial circus clown act called Billy Buttons, or the Dressmaker's Trip To Brentford. His act was based upon a preferred tale of a dressmaker, an inept equestrian, trying to ride a horse to Brentford to elect in an election.


Initially he had terrific difficulty installing the equine appropriately, and after that when he ultimately prospered the horse started so fast that he dropped off. As the circus expanded and Astley hired other clowns, he required them to discover Billy Buttons - Corporate events Dallas. It quickly became a standard component of every circus for the following century
